Description

Bushy, lax habit plants, quickly get established and will soon become clothed in a mass of very attractive, candy-pink, cup-shaped flowers.

Spectacular in cottage garden borders over a long flowering period.

Height: 120cm (4ft).

Sowing Instructions

Sowing time: September to May.

Sow seeds on the surface of lightly firmed, moist seed compost in pots or trays and cover with a sprinkling of compost or vermiculite. Place container in a propagator or seal inside a polythene bag and keep at a temperature of between 15-20ºC (59-68ºF). After sowing, do not exclude light as this helps germination. Keep the surface of the compost moist but not waterlogged; germination usually takes 7-21 days.

Growing Instructions

When large enough to handle, transplant seedlings into 7.5cm (3in) pots or trays. Plant out once plants are well grown, 45-60cm (18-24in) apart.

Aftercare

For best results, provide a well-drained soil in full sun.

Overwinter September sowings in a cold frame and plant out the following spring.
